Business Overview

Franklin India Arbitrage Fund (IDCW) is a unique investment option designed for investors seeking to benefit from market inefficiencies while minimizing risk. Ideal for conservative investors and those looking for stable returns, this fund employs a market-neutral strategy to generate income. It plays a crucial role in diversifying your portfolio, especially in volatile markets, providing a balance between equity and fixed income.
